Dr. Fereidoun Rezanezhad
Fereidoun received his Ph.D. from the University of Heidelberg, Germany in 2007. His Ph.D. research applied light transmission methods and image processing to the study of water flow through porous media. In August 2007, he joined the Cold Regions Research Centre as Visiting Research Scientist. He is now developing new analytical methods of measuring the physical and hydraulic properties of peat soils using X-ray computed tomography.
